Business Intelligence Engineer I

Remote · USA Full-time New today

Centene Corporation is a diversified national organization focused on improving health outcomes through technology. They are seeking a Business Intelligence Engineer I to create reports and visualizations that aid in business decision-making and support the development of Business Intelligence solutions.

Responsibilities

  • Develops BI solution architecture that accurately translates business requirements to technology and ensures the design will meet business requirements throughout the lifecycle of a change
  • Supports day-to-day activities related to defining architecture, establishing infrastructure, and implementing standards used to create a framework for delivering business intelligence solutions
  • Conducts business analysis activities to enable technology solutions that adequately fulfill strategic business needs and objectives
  • Performs project setups, analysis, designs, etc., for and with customers
  • Supports the execution of long-term strategic goals for Business Intelligence development in conjunction with end users, managers, clients, and other stakeholders
  • Conducts research and make recommendations on Business Intelligence products, services, and standards in support of procurement and development efforts
  • Performs and oversee programming, quality assurance reviews, documentation, system deployment, training, and project setup / support
  • Designs, develops, supports, and debugs Business Objects universes and reports
  • Provides timely and appropriate communication to business owners, stakeholders, and users on issue status and resolution
  • Develops and maintain the Business Intelligence architecture at Centene
  • Oversees ongoing development and operations of the Business Intelligence tools and reports
  • Collaborates with end users to identify needs and opportunities for improved data management and delivery
  • Collaborates with Enterprise Architecture on the solution design to ensure it conforms to enterprise architectural standards and future roadmaps
  • Performs other duties as assigned
  • Complies with all policies and standards

Skills

  • A Bachelor's degree in a quantitative or business field (e.g., statistics, mathematics, engineering, computer science)
  • 0 – 2 years of related experience
  • Experience with Microsoft Azure; SQL Server System
  • Experience with Other Developing SQL code, testing for quality assurance, administering RDBMS and monitoring of database
  • Knowledge of Data Modeling
  • Beginner - Seeks to acquire knowledge in area of specialty
  • Beginner - Ability to identify basic problems and procedural irregularities, collect data, establish facts, and draw valid conclusions
